Guanyang Wang (@GuanyangW) · 13h My friend Zhengqing used GPT-5.6 to solve a beautiful well-known conjecture in probability. Feige's 1/e conjecture: for independent nonnegative X_1,...,X_n with E[X_i] ≤ 1 and S_n = X_1+...+X_n, we have P(S_n ≤ E[S_n] + 1) ≥ 1/e. Exciting to see a problem we used to kick around over lunch and dinner get solved! 1/2
